

The International Master of Landscape Architecture is a distinguished graduate program jointly offered by HfWU Nürtingen-Geislingen and the University of Applied Sciences Weihenstephan-Triesdorf. Designed for students and professionals seeking to advance their expertise, this full-time international degree integrates academic depth with practical, application-oriented training. Participants gain hands-on experience in European planning cultures, environmental design, and digital planning technologies, preparing them for complex challenges in contemporary landscape architecture. The program is structured across three semesters and admits students exclusively in the summer semester.
Located in Nürtingen, a dynamic academic hub within southern Germany, this master’s program emphasizes creative innovation and sustainable design. With a strong focus on interdisciplinary project work and international collaboration, students not only develop advanced design and planning skills but also benefit from valuable global networking opportunities. Graduates of the International Master of Landscape Architecture are equipped for leading roles in urban and regional planning, environmental design, sustainable development, and international landscape projects. Career paths include landscape architect, environmental planner, urban designer, project manager, and consultant for public or private sector organizations.
